Samsung celebrates Olympic Day 2023 with new step challenge

Featured image for Samsung celebrates Olympic Day 2023 with new step challenge

Samsung has announced a new step challenge for Samsung Health users in some countries. The Samsung Health Olympic Day Step Challenge celebrates International Olympic Day 2023, which is observed on June 23 every year since 1948. It commemorates the founding of the International Olympic Committee (IOC) on 23 June 1894.

Samsung’s Olympic Day Step Challenge is available in Australia, Brazil, Canada, France, Germany, India, Italy, Japan, Mexico, New Zealand, Saudi Arabia, Singapore, South Korea, Spain, Switzerland, the UK, the US, and the UAE. It encourages Samsung health users in these countries to “log steps, stay active, and enjoy the significant health benefits of daily movement.”

Interested users can participate in this challenge through a banner under the Together tab of the Samsung Health app. The banner is already live. Simply tap on the “Join now” button in the banner and you’re in. The challenge itself begins on June 10 and runs through June 23. The overall target is 100,000 steps. Anything from a joyful dance or a walk to a revitalizing run and taking the stairs at work will count. Samsung Health will encourage participants with a congratulations message at every 20,000-step milestone.

Once the challenge is live, you can visit the Together tab to access the “Challenge Map”. Here, you can see your total step count and ranking in the global chart. If you complete the challenge (100,000 steps), you’ll get a unique “Olympic Day Badge” on your Samsung Health profile. You can check your badges in the My Page tab of the app. If you want to leave the challenge, you can do that from the ellipsis button (three vertical dots) in the top right corner of the challenge page. Samsung plans to organize more such large-scale events for the 64 million Samsung Health users around the world.

This Samsung Health step challenge is part of the IOC’s Let’s Move initiative

Samsung’s new step challenge is part of the IOC’s Let’s Move initiative launched on the occasion of this year’s Olympic Day. The initiative aims to inspire the world to move more every day. “Movement can make us feel amazing. Daily physical activity has multiple health benefits for our bodies, hearts, and minds. That’s why on Olympic Day on 23rd June, we invite the world to join us and celebrate the joy of moving by building physical activity into our daily lives,” the IOC says. Samsung Health will invite participants in this step challenge to join the initiative with every milestone message.
